What is an RF intern?

An RF intern is a student or entry-level professional gaining hands-on experience in radio frequency communications, often working with antennas, signal testing, and wireless systems. The role typically involves supporting engineering teams with testing, data analysis, and learning industry-standard tools like spectrum analyzers and RF simulation software.

Is RF engineering in demand?

RF engineering is in high demand due to the growth of wireless communication, 5G networks, and IoT devices. RF engineers are needed to design, test, and optimize radio frequency systems, often requiring knowledge of tools like spectrum analyzers and certifications such as FCC licensing. The field offers strong job prospects in telecommunications, defense, and technology sectors.

What is the difference between Intern Rf Communications Engineer vs Rf Communications Engineer?

AspectIntern Rf Communications EngineerRf Communications Engineer
QualificationsEnrolled in or recent graduate of relevant engineering programsBachelor's or higher in Electrical Engineering or related field, with relevant certifications
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, supervised, entry-level tasksFull-time professional role, responsible for design, testing, and deployment
ResponsibilitiesAssisting with RF system testing, data collection, and basic analysisDesigning RF systems, troubleshooting, and project management

The main difference lies in experience and responsibility level. Intern Rf Communications Engineers are typically students or recent graduates gaining practical experience, while Rf Communications Engineers are fully employed professionals handling complex tasks and projects.

Are you experienced with RF systems design, analysis, and development for space and ground segments?

Are you a clear thinker with good interpersonal skills, and effective communications skills?

If so, we 're looking for someone like you to join our team at APL!

We are seeking an RF systems engineer to design, analyze and develop NASA and DoD 's next generation spacecraft. You 'll be joining a hard-working team of engineers who thrive on making critical contributions to our Nation's critical challenges. Our culture embraces our core values of unquestionable integrity, trusted service to our nation, world-class expertise, game-changing impact, highly collaborative, and even fun environment!

As an RF Systems Engineer you will...

  • You will perform conceptual systems design, simulation, link analysis, hardware trade studies, technical tradeoffs, and costing for satellite communications and RF system design concepts for both space and ground segments.
  • You will work with mission and spacecraft systems engineers, peer subsystem engineers and project management in overall mission development and execution from concept to launch, including technical concept design, requirements,development phases, technical reviews, budget development and schedule.
  • You will lead technical teams throughout the RF systems development cycle, including system concept, trade studies,prototype work, flight development, integration, and test.
  • You will assist project and program management in sponsor engagement.

Qualifications

You meet our minimum qualifications for the job if you have...

  • A BS or MS in Electrical Engineering or equivalent.
  • 5+ years direct experience in satellite RF communications and RF systems design, development, simulation (MATLAB,SystemVue, or equivalent) and operations.
  • Experience in RF hardware design and/or testing.
  • Are willing and able to accommodate: flexible hours for spacecraft level testing activities for short periods of time, infrequent travel to customer or sponsor locations as well as spacecraft integration and test sites.
  • Are able to obtain a Top Secret level security clearance by your start date and can ultimately obtain a TS/SCI+poly level clearance. If selected, you will be subject to a government security clearance investigation and must meet the requirements for access to classified information. Eligibility requirements include U.S. citizenship.

You 'll go above and beyond our minimum requirements if you have...

  • PhD degree in Electrical Engineering with previous RF systems design leadership experience.
  • Experience with software-defined radios SDR, antennas, RF characterization and measurements to Ka-band or beyond, Radar systems design, military satellite communications systems.
  • Ability to work independently without technical oversight.
  • Other key skills: Solid State Power Amplifier SSPA design, RF / microwave circuit design, Digital Signal Processing DSP, SIGINT, Precision Timing, and Time Transfer, Radar Design
